Memorial Univ. of Newfoundland, Canada. Addresses the concerns of healthcare professionals and students regarding the provision of healthcare. Draws heavily on literary voices, the visual arts, and popular culture to chart the changes in public perception in recent years. Can serve as a study for the medical humanities and professionalism.
